Applications Accepted Until the 25th

Cheonjae Education announced on the 19th that it will hold an online seminar titled "Reflecting the 2022 Revised Curriculum! The Most Noteworthy Latest Textbook Selection Guide (Guide!)" on the 26th.


This seminar is designed to provide practical information to teachers and parents who are considering which mathematics textbooks to select in the educational field, by presenting a roadmap for elementary, middle, and high school math reference books, as well as introducing the lineup, structure, composition, and features of key textbooks by subject area. During the seminar, the latest textbooks reflecting the 2022 revised curriculum, including new releases, will be introduced, and a textbook selection guide will be offered, recommending types of academies based on the characteristics of each textbook.

In addition, the "Cheonjae Education Elementary, Middle, and High School Math Reference Book Road Map" will be provided to give participants an at-a-glance overview of various Cheonjae Education math reference books, aiming to help them select the right textbooks and establish effective learning plans.


Benefits are also available for seminar participants. All attendees will receive a PDF file of the "Cheonjae Education Elementary, Middle, and High School Math Reference Book Road Map." In addition, by submitting a survey after the seminar, participants will be entered into a drawing to win a "Check Check Middle School Math Formula Book & 2026" Cheonjae Math Catalog (200 winners) or a Mega Coffee Iced Americano mobile coupon (100 winners). Furthermore, teaching material sets for the "Middle School Check Check Math Series," "High School Concept Book ZIP," and "High School Type Book ZIP" will be provided to a total of six teachers, with two winners for each set.


The seminar will be broadcast live via real-time streaming on the official YouTube channel, Real Chunjae Story, from 9:30 a.m. to 10:50 a.m. on March 26. Applications to participate can be submitted via Naver Form until the 25th.



A Cheonjae Education representative stated, "We plan to continue providing a variety of content and information that will be helpful in the educational field going forward."
